Baiduspider IP addresses

Indexes pages for Baidu Search. Baidu publishes no address ranges for Baiduspider; it documents a reverse DNS check instead, which the IP lookup performs when asked for the hostname. This page is that check, spelled out.

How to verify a visitor is Baiduspider

Look up the PTR record of the request's source address and confirm the name ends in crawl.baidu.com or crawl.baidu.jp. Then resolve that name forward and confirm one of its addresses is the address you started from — a PTR record alone can be set to anything by whoever controls the reverse zone, and the forward confirmation is what makes it proof. Baidu documents this check as the way to verify Baiduspider.

What the API answers for one of its addresses

A lookup of an address whose verified hostname sits under those domains answers is_crawler true, names it in crawler and classes it in crawler_kind. A crawler carries no risk weight, and the datacenter weight is skipped for it: its operator is known and its infrastructure is the point. The hostname check is a live DNS query, so it runs only when the lookup asks for it with hostname: true.

A range proves the operator, not intent. Whether Baiduspider is welcome on a site is a robots.txt decision; this page and the lookup only settle whether a request that says it is Baiduspider really came from Baidu.
